Genus Rhynchium Spinola

Rhynchium Spinola 1806: 84, genus, emendation of Rygchium validated by Opinion 747 (no. 1688 of Official List of Generic Names in Zoology).

Type species: Rygchium [!] europaeum Spinola 1806 [= Vespa oculata Fabricius 1781], by monotypy (no. 2095 of Official List of Specific Names in Zoology).

Rygchium Spinola 1806: 84, genus. Incorrect original spelling of Rhynchium Spinola, placed on Official Index of Rejected and Invalid Generic Names in Zoology (as no. 1768) by Opinion 747.

Rhynchium Billberg 1820: 109 . Emendation of Rychium [!] Spinola; validated and placed on Official List of Generic Names in Zoology (as no. 1688) by Opinion 747.

Rychium [!] Billberg 1820: 109 . Placed on Official Index of Rejected and Invalid Generic Names in Zoology (as no. 1769) by Opinion 747.

Rynchium Sturm 1829: 12 . Unjustified emendation of Rhynchium Spinola, placed on Official Index of Rejected and Invalid Generic Names in Zoology (as no. 1770) by Opinion 747.

Rhygchium [!] de Saussure 1853: xxxi, 276. Placed on Official Index of Rejected and Invalid Generic Names in Zoology (as no. 1771) by Opinion 747.

Eurrhynchium Dalla Torre 1904: 33, name for division II of Rhynchium Spinola in de Saussure 1852: 105 .

Type species: Vespa oculata Fabricius 1781, by subsequent designation of van der Vecht & Carpenter 1990: 23.

Taxonomy: de Saussure 1863: 242 (Index; Rhynchuium [!]).—van der Vecht 1963b: 234 (proposed emendation).— ICZN 1965, Opinion 747: 186 (validation of emendation).— Willink 1982: 195 (Rygohium [!]).— Cardale 1985: 203–205 (cat. Australian species).

Distribution: Widespread in the Old World, from the Afrotropics to Oceania; most diverse in the Oriental Region.

Ethology: One Australian species, R. mirabile (as R. rothi), has been reported to build mud cells on a substrate; elsewhere the nests are in pre-existing cavities; prey: caterpillars.
